For this show, every piece you see in the pictures was fully constructed by my co-costumer, with a little help from our supervisor and intern at the time. Technically my co-costumer was the head designer for this one but we found it best to put our heads together and design the show between the two of us. He designed the base costumes and I came up with any additional pieces that the actor wore. I would sketch up a quick design, run it by him and then we went from there about how to go about making it. What you see to the right is the design board that we made for this show, it's the only one we ever made during our time at ECCT and you will notice that some of our designs changed entirely. I draped and constructed any piece that you see that is weaved and or quilted. The shop that we worked in came with minimal resources, so I ended up sort of 'guessing' on most things, using dress forms for draping that were sort of close to the actors' size and then adjusting it as a flat pattern. We also ended up modifying commercial patterns. Of course, then each garment was fit and altered to the corresponding actor.
